titleOfInvention Method of magnetic resonance imaging
abstract A method of magnetic resonance imaging of the kidney in a vascularised human or non human body wherein a blood pool MR contrast agent, preferably a paramagnetic contrast agent, is administered as a bolus into the vasculature of said body and images of said kidney are generated using imaging sequences and timing to permit both visualisation and gradation of renal artery stenosis and quantification of renal perfusion, and, optionally, values indicative of renal artery stenosis grade and renal perfusion are generated from said images. Preferably, T2*-weighted images are generated during the first pass T1- weighted images are generated. after the concentration of contrast agent throughout the blood has become substantially uniform.
